Bedtime

Our bedtime routine at our house is very predictable. With Cael ,bedtime is as easy as reading a few books, saying our prayers, and pushing play for his bedtime music. Jordan on the other hand has definitely come up with her own complex routine of what needs to be done before she will even consider going to sleep.
  • First- she needs to read her books
  • Second- she needs to get as many hugs and kisses from brother as she possibly can before I finally get fed up and tell her that is enough.
  • Third- she has to say her prayers, while stopping every few seconds to say, "don't help me Mom! "
  • Fourth- she has to make sure that all her toys and things are put away in the right places. After she is lying down if she sees one thing that is out of place she will quickly jump up out of bed and be sure to tell me what it is where it needs to go.
  • Fifth- she has to look out the window to tell me that our Vegetable garden is still there and growing tall.
  • Sixth- she has to push play on the CD player to turn on her bedtime music.
  • Seventh- she has to have her drink of water
  • Eighth- She always tells me to get her a "kenex" because she has "bad boogers"
  • Ninth- she has to pick out the blanket that she wants to sleep with
  • Tenth- She always looks down at my feet and asks "do you have shoes on?" and if I don't she always responds with "oh, just your foots"
  • Eleventh- She always says"hold me" while we listen to a song...or two until she will finally let me lay her in her bed.

Some nights, OK most nights, this list of "must do's" just makes me crazy. But on those nights when I am not here and either Raynel or his Mom are putting the kids to bed I really do get a little sad.

Cael, Thank you for taking after your Dad and realising that a true bedtime routine is nothing more then a bed, and pillow, t and then within seconds, sleep. I love to hear you say your prayers and how you never fail to say how thankful you are for your Mom and Dad.

Jordan, I am not sure where you got some of your OCD. But you never fail to find away to make me laugh and melt my heart even when you are making me crazy. I love to see your cute little face when you squint up your eyes, point one finger and say," stay for one more song mom, one more".
